You may be inclined to ask how the company can afford to offer free Direct TV systems. The answer to this is simple. First of all, the company is not making but in fact is losing money in giving away the hardware of their product, however, what they gain, a new customer, is far more valuable in the long run. Because Direct TV is betting that you will love their service so much, they are counting on continuing to service you for a long time, thus providing them with their income. Their money is made on the programming, even with the price of it so low to customers.
